      <description>&lt;P&gt;I agree, with all of the above...... get your utilization way down from where it is.&amp;nbsp; &amp;nbsp;Eighty six / 86 % is way too high..... get it under 50% quickly.... but your goals should be under 30%...... and really UNDER 8.9 %.&amp;nbsp; At 86 % you have to hope you don't get CL decreases.&amp;nbsp; Even if you do get approved for a car loan..... your interest will be mucher higher than if your utilization was lower &amp;amp; your score higher.&amp;nbsp; The difference can mean thousands of dollars over the term of the loan.&amp;nbsp; &amp;nbsp; &amp;nbsp;Pay down balances &amp;amp; and try to use cards less....&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Another thing I would do is rotate your card usage, pay down the cards as much as possible right before the statement cuts..... and only use cards after they cut, so as to give you more time to pay, and pay down the balance again..... that may help a bit to get your scores up.&lt;/P&gt;</description>

      <description>&lt;P&gt;Agree with &lt;a href="https://ficoforums.myfico.com/t5/user/viewprofilepage/user-id/875377"&gt;@SouthJamaica&lt;/a&gt;: Paying it down under 10% isn't enough. You need to pay it &lt;EM&gt;all&lt;/EM&gt; off. Getting &lt;EM&gt;reported&lt;/EM&gt; utilization down under 10% is useful for optimizing your credit score when you're applying for new credit, but if you're carrying a single dollar past the due date, you're paying sky high interest rates, which means you're not managing your money well. Consider talking to a credit union about a debt consolidation loan, if you can't do it fairly quickly.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Also, if you really need a car you really need a car, but get a cheaper and/or older one than you were planning. The goal should be to get your finances in order first. And once that happens, your credit score will take care of itself (your fundamentals sound okay).&lt;/P&gt;</description>
